how to mend bent arm on rotary airer?

is it possible to fix something on to straighten the bent arm on a rotary washing line? I think my son bent it with vigourous play, he likes spinning the line around, however much I ask him not to, he says it wasn't him .:rolleyes: I've tried bending the arm back into straight line, but it just re-creases when wet washing is hung on the line, and the washing lines get all tangled.

it' s a minky brand and the 4 arms are made from bent galvanised aluminium(?) , so it's not as solid as it looks in the pics.

  • Hi,

    looks as though the arms are hollow, so once you get the offending arm straightened you could maybe push a solid rod of sorts into it,

    try a good squirt of WD40 on the 'rotalift', it has maybe seized up.

    Looks like the the arms are roll formed galvanised steel. The trouble is, its kinked at some point. Even if you bend it back, it will still have a bit of a kink in it, and the bending will have weakened it from it original strength.
    If you do it a few more times, it will probably break right off.

    A bar of some sort inside the channel and fixed at each end would probably solve it. Its fixing it that will make the difference in a channel.
